They (USCF) might call these online blitz events tournaments but they don't have entry fees or prizes so basically they are just to get a blitz rating. (If there was $$$ I would probably try to make a comeback and play all the games.) The point of withdrawing then is to play until you feel you are declining. I mostly do correspondence events which is the opposite of blitz (like training for marathons then running sprints) so these blitz events take a lot of concentration for me to move every few seconds. The plan was to withdraw after a single round but due to being the final game to finish in round 1 it automatically paired us for r2.
